Job overview

The Learning & Enterprise College Bexley is a vibrant; financially secure adult education institution responsible for delivering high quality outcomes for students, residents and employers, while contributing to the strategic objectives laid out in Bexley Council’s corporate priorities for adult learning, employment and wellbeing. The college consists of approx. 1000 courses with 13,000 enrolments through 5,000 students.

We are looking for a highly motivated individual to manage the development and implementation of quality improvement strategies, frameworks and procedures across Adult Education provision, to raise standards and ensure outstanding quality of provision. The role involves ensuring that provision remains compliant with external regulatory frameworks, ensuring the effective and efficient operation of quality assurance and improvement procedures, and managing relationships with curriculum staff to promote sharing of best practice and to ensure high standards.
